This is also a small problem in Chinese mathematics.
It is not that there was no geometry in ancient China. It is because ancient Chinese mathematics did not value orientation and angle, but they valued calculations. In ancient mathematics, there was no concept of angle. In astronomy, although there were angles, the angle was not 360 degrees. Astronomers had different algorithms, but they all had the same fraction, which was 365 and 1-quarter, and other numbers.
These are more about calculating the trajectory of celestial bodies.
This concept is not extended to other aspects.
And there is another reason, that is, the inheritance of books is not easy.
Take the simplest example as an example. Liu Hui’s annotated version of "Nine Chapters of Arithmetic" has a picture. Liu Hui used many pictures to explain some mathematical problems, but there was no picture in the version of Nine Chapters of arithmetic that was passed down in later generations. Even if there were pictures, it was later generations who made up for it according to Liu Hui's words. I don’t know whether it was Liu Hui’s original intention.
This is a common phenomenon. First, there is no common way to draw pictures, and every mathematician has his own ideas. Moreover, pictures are more difficult to preserve and copy than words.
This also led to ancient mathematicians preferring to express themselves in words.
